Both bandanna and bandana are correct spellings of the same word. However, bandana is the more common and widely accepted spelling in modern English, especially in dictionaries, fashion websites, and online searches. Bandanna is an alternative spelling that still appears in some publications, brands, and regional usage. For SEO and professional writing in 2026, bandana is generally the preferred choice.

History of the Word
Origin
The word comes from the Hindi word bandhnu or bandhana, which relates to tying or binding cloth.
Entry into English
The term entered English through trade and textile markets.
Spelling Evolution
Over time, both spellings developed:
- Bandana
- Bandanna
Eventually, bandana became more dominant.
